Cheapest Available Thornhill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Thornhill area of Mobile, AL is a 1 Bed unit found at Robinwood priced from $699. Twin Oaks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$720. Here are the most affordable Thornhill apartments for rent in Mobile, AL: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Thornhill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Thornhill?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Thornhill is under $1,066.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Thornhill?

The cheapest apartment in Thornhill is Robinwood which is listed at $699, while the average apartment in Thornhill costs $2,399.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Thornhill?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 3 regular apartments in Thornhill that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.

How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Thornhill?

Cheap apartments in Thornhill have an average cost of $467 which is $1,932 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Thornhill.
